Output 34b393668ddb85b60f83e77794a6cb68ca922f1c8bd9182822aa5dd6706e41b9:0

value
5700000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 83435e606a725cdbbbded7250422cd2694bdacbc OP_EQUAL
address
3Df59XhC4tSB954kovbqvoRBxzR1uuYsWB
transaction
34b393668ddb85b60f83e77794a6cb68ca922f1c8bd9182822aa5dd6706e41b9
spent
true